In 2014, Reynolds Excavation, Demolition & Utilities implemented Viewpoint Spectrum as its Construction ERP. The deployment centralized financials, job costing, project management and payroll for a 50 employee construction and real estate services firm. Configuration emphasized core Viewpoint Spectrum modules including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, field labor costing, equipment and asset tracking and project cost control. Estimating workflows were organized to receive takeoff and estimate inputs from tools the team uses such as Bid 2 Win, Trimble Business Center and PlanSwift, while contract documents and custom reporting relied on Microsoft Word and Microsoft Excel integrated into operational workflows with Viewpoint Spectrum. Automation for billing cycles, change order processing and subcontractor pay applications was implemented using standard Spectrum functional workflows. Operational coverage extended across accounting, estimating, project management and field operations, with governance built around a standardized chart of accounts, job numbering and monthly close procedures. Rollout prioritized user training and standard operating procedures, leveraging existing team skills in Viewpoint and office productivity tools to drive adoption. Documentation and reporting templates were configured to align estimating, project controls and finance teams on cost capture and billing.

In 2015, Reynolds Excavation, Demolition & Utilities implemented Microsoft 365 as its Collaboration platform. The deployment used Microsoft 365 cloud services to centralize email, file storage, and team collaboration across office staff and field site managers. The implementation scope covered core Collaboration capabilities such as Exchange Online for corporate email, SharePoint Online for document libraries and project records, Microsoft Teams for chat and meeting coordination, and OneDrive for file sync and mobile access. The company website contains public signals referencing Microsoft 365, indicating the platform is also active in web facing communications. Administration and governance were structured for a small 50 person organization, using Microsoft 365 administrative roles, user provisioning, security groups, and basic compliance controls to manage accounts and access. Operational workflows aligned with construction and utilities functions, focusing on project document control, contractor and site coordination, and centralized communications between back office and field crews. The configuration emphasized cloud hosted Collaboration modules to reduce on premise infrastructure and enable remote access for mobile crews.
